|
钻瓜专利网为您找到相关结果 1083394个,建议您 升级VIP下载更多相关专利
- [发明专利]一种内存池的管理方法-CN201810024399.5有效
-
张梦涵;张文明;陈少杰
-
武汉斗鱼网络科技有限公司
-
2018-01-10
-
2020-07-31
-
G06F9/50
- 本发明公开了一种内存池的管理方法,该方法包括:控制第一内存池提供动态内存分配操作和内存释放操作,并且控制第二内存池不提供动态内存分配操作和内存释放操作;在第一内存池的已分配内存大于第一阈值且已使用内存小于第二阈值时,控制第一内存池仅提供内存释放操作,并且控制第二内存池提供动态内存分配操作和内存释放操作;在第一内存池的内存全部释放之后,清空第一内存池,以及控制第二内存池提供动态内存分配操作和内存释放操作,并且控制第一内存池不提供动态内存分配操作和内存释放操作本发明解决了现有技术中存在的因内存池的chunk地址并非连续而无法释放整块block,导致内存占有量较高的技术问题,实现了将空闲内存自动回收的技术效果。
- 一种内存管理方法
- [发明专利]一种小型CPU内存管理方法-CN202211387670.4在审
-
王雨龙
-
天津津航计算技术研究所
-
2022-11-07
-
2023-01-31
-
G06F9/50
- 本发明公开了一种小型CPU内存管理方法,其包括以下步骤:S1:设计一种内存池结构类型strupool;S2:在CPU内存空间中定义内存池g_pool变量;S3:对S2中定义的内存池g_pool变量进行初始化操作;S4:定义内存信息管理结构体struinfo;S5:进行内存申请操作;S6:对申请到的内存进行释放操作;S7打开临界区,使系统进入内核状态,关闭中断以及调度等操作,内存空间释放完成。本发明在内存中开辟了一段空间,通过对这段空间进行管理,内存申请效率高,同时在内存释放时,对这段空间的内存进行重新排布,避免了内存碎片的产生。
- 一种小型cpu内存管理方法
- [发明专利]一种高效的先进先出数据池读写方法-CN200910109275.8无效
-
汤敏
-
深圳市融创天下科技发展有限公司
-
2009-08-06
-
2010-03-17
-
G06F12/08
- 一种高效的先进先出数据池读写方法,其具体如下:写入数据时包括如下步骤:步骤一:建立一个数据内存池,该内存池是从内存中划分若干内存块,内存块由头部开始写入数据,并由尾部建立管理数据,由内存块组成一个循环链表;步骤二:当用户申请大小为buffer.len的内存时,依链表顺序判断当前内存块是否满足条件,是则执行步骤三,否则执行步骤四;步骤三:向该满足条件的当前内存块写入数据buffer.len,并在该内存块尾部建立相应的管理数据,所述管理数据占用固定大小的字节数;步骤四:继续判断下一个内存块是否满足条件,是则执行步骤三,否则继续判断下一个内存块是否满足条件,直到所有内存块均不满足条件时,结束。
- 一种高效先进数据读写方法
- [发明专利]一种内存管理方法、电子设备及介质-CN202110199568.0在审
-
宁安;肖文文
-
北京青云科技股份有限公司
-
2021-02-22
-
2021-05-18
-
G06F9/50
- 本发明公开了一种内存管理方法、电子设备及介质。该方法包括:根据内存空间请求在初始化内存池集合选取内存池,并在所述内存池内以最小分配单元获取适配的插槽;根据所述插槽在所述初始化内存池集合对应的全局暂缓释放区查找可用内存空间;若所述全局暂缓释放区中不存在,则在所述插槽的当前分配器的分配内存空间查找可用内存空间;若所述当前分配器的分配内存空间在不存在可用内存空间,则在所述内存池中其他插槽中查找可用内存空间;若所述内存池中其他插槽中不存在可用内存空间,则从所述初始化内存池集合其他内存池进行分配本发明实施例提供的内存管理方法能快速查找可用内存空间,从而提高了内存空间的利用率和分配效率。
- 一种内存管理方法电子设备介质
- [发明专利]段页结合的内存管理方法-CN201910763767.2有效
-
郑岩;王星焱;黄高阳;林海南;刘松;邹通
-
无锡江南计算技术研究所
-
2019-08-19
-
2022-07-12
-
G06F9/50
- 本发明公开一种段页结合的内存管理方法,包括以下步骤:S1、获取整个服务器上可供使用的物理内存;S2、从可供使用的物理内存中预留一段或多段连续物理内存,并将预留的连续物理内存加入段式物理内存资源池;S3、将可供使用的物理内存中未被加入段式物理内存资源池的剩余物理内存加入页式物理内存资源池;S4、当计算部件需要物理内存时,通过段式内存申请接口向段式物理内存资源池申请物理内存;S5、当普通用户程序需要物理内存时,操作系统内核将申请的物理内存空间大小与处理器支持的大页页面大小进行比较。本发明通过灵活的内存管理策略,解决了特殊计算部件对大块连续物理内存的需求,同时兼顾普通用户程序内存使用的需求,灵活适应不同的内存需求场景。
- 结合内存管理方法
- [发明专利]一种内存管理的方法以及设备-CN202310481416.9在审
-
林峰
-
深圳华为云计算技术有限公司
-
2023-04-27
-
2023-08-25
-
G06F9/50
- 本申请提供了一种内存管理的方法以及设备,方法包括:响应于满足第一触发条件,对N个计算节点进行内存分配限速以使N个计算节对部属在N个计算节点上的业务实例进行内存分配限速;在对N个计算节点执行内存分配限速时,向第一计算节点迁移第一数据,和/或将业务实例迁移到第二计算节点,通过本申请提供的内存管理方法,可以在第一内存池存在热点时,对计算节点进行内存分配限速,延长第一内存池被占满的时间,并在内存分配限速期间,将第一内存池的部分数据迁移至第一计算节点,和/或将第一计算节点的业务实例迁移至第二计算节点以缓解第一内存池的压力,防止第一内存池爆仓,避免系统卡死,保证了重要业务的运行。
- 一种内存管理方法以及设备
- [发明专利]内存管理方法及电子设备-CN202210332074.X在审
-
李佳伟;季柯丞;方锦轩;杨文飞
-
华为技术有限公司
-
2022-03-30
-
2023-10-24
-
G06F9/50
- 一种内存管理方法及电子设备,涉及终端技术领域,能够提升内存管理效率。方法应用于电子设备,电子设备包括第一内存池和第二内存池,第一内存池中的内存优先分配给第一类型的进程,第二内存池中的内存优先分配给第二类型的进程,该方法包括:接收第一进程的第一内存申请请求;获取第一进程所需的内存大小;若第一进程的类型为第二类型,且第二内存池的容量大于或等于第一进程所需内存大小,则从第二内存池中为第一进程分配内存;或者,若第一进程的类型为第二类型,第二内存池的容量小于第一进程所需的内存大小,且不存在申请内存的第一类型的进程,第一内存池的容量大于或等于第一进程所需的内存大小,则从第一内存池中为第一进程分配内存。
- 内存管理方法电子设备
|